Core Skills Analysis
Mathematics
- The student practiced basic counting by ensuring that the right number of Lego pieces were used for their structure.
- They explored geometry concepts by creating various shapes and understanding the spatial relationship between different Lego bricks.
- Through measurements of their Lego creations, they developed a sense of size, area, and volume.
- The student demonstrated pattern recognition by repeating specific design sequences in their Lego construction.
Science
- The activity encouraged the exploration of engineering concepts as the student built structures, testing their stability and height.
- Through trial and error, the child learned about gravity and balance, observing how certain structures collapsed and others stood firm.
- The student engaged in problem-solving by modifying their designs when pieces didn’t fit as intended or their structures failed.
- They experienced kinesthetic learning by actively manipulating the bricks, thus solidifying their understanding of physical properties.
Art and Design
- The student expressed creativity through color selection and the artistic arrangement of their Lego bricks.
- They developed an appreciation for symmetry and asymmetry in their designs, experimenting with visual balance.
- By designing unique structures, the child enhanced their spatial awareness and ability to visualize projects before execution.
- The activity allowed for personal expression as the student interpreted themes or stories through their Lego creations.
Social Studies
- The student learned about community by constructing elements that symbolize aspects of their neighborhood or city.
- They engaged in collaborative play if working with peers, practicing communication and teamwork skills.
- The student could explore cultural aspects by recreating architectural styles from different parts of the world.
- By discussing their creations, they practiced storytelling, which helped in understanding narratives in social contexts.
Tips
To further enhance the child’s learning experience, I suggest incorporating additional themes or challenges related to their Lego building. For instance, setting up a mini-city project could help integrate concepts of urban planning and community roles. Additionally, introducing time limits or specific prompts might encourage critical thinking and quick problem-solving. Partnering with local schools or libraries to organize a Lego-building competition could also boost social skills and collaboration.
